Output d25715b655117d4b444da73d41fe0946ad76e8864dbd73cb9601b864e4eab6dd:5

value
266936356
script pubkey
OP_HASH160 OP_PUSHBYTES_20 588908649d24805ea239bd3567c88b2b9e760c31 OP_EQUAL
address
39m9YdUTM2R3JhHTAUyfoDYXymn8JrP5ny
transaction
d25715b655117d4b444da73d41fe0946ad76e8864dbd73cb9601b864e4eab6dd
spent
true